A very typical budget hotel like the uks travelodges in the suburbs of dresden. It has underground parking and is only a couple of very short bus stops from the centre. It also did a very fine breakfast buffet, however no air con in the relatively small rooms & you had to pay for wi-fi. Ok for a business or... More

I was looking for a resonably priced hotel within walking distance to the Central Rail Station. It is approximately a 10 minute walk from the bahnhof but in the opposite direction of Dresden's attractions. The room was spartan, with a small tv, desk and two single beds but more than adequate for solo traveller. The toilet with shower was simple... More
